Gophers add 2 recruits for next year's class

Last update: November 12, 2009 - 5:54 AM

The Minnesota men's basketball has added two more recruits for next season.

Wednesday was signing day for national letters of intent. The Gophers will give scholarships to 6-foot-11 center Elliott Eliason and 6-foot-4 shooting guard Austin Hollins.

Coach Tubby Smith is still recruiting for next year's class, so there could be more. The Gophers will lose three seniors from the current team, small forward Damian Johnson and shooting guards Lawrence Westbrook and Devron Bostick.

Eliason is from Chadron, Neb.

Hollins is from Germantown, Tenn. He's the son of Memphis Grizzlies head coach Lionel Hollins.

The Gophers open the regular season on Friday against Tennessee Tech.
